走啊走
加油

云服务器部署Web服务,Ubuntu Server和Debian哪个镜像更稳定轻量?

服务器价格表

在云服务器部署 Web 服务(如 Nginx/Apache + PHP/Python + MySQL/PostgreSQL)的场景下,Debian 和 Ubuntu Server 实际上都非常稳定、轻量且成熟,但若严格对比「稳定性」和「轻量性」,结论如下:

推荐优先选择:Debian Stable(如 Debian 12 "Bookworm")
→ 更符合“稳定优先、极致轻量”的需求。

🔍 关键对比分析:

维度 Debian Stable Ubuntu Server LTS
稳定性 ⭐⭐⭐⭐⭐
以「保守、经过充分测试」著称;软件包版本较旧但极少引入回归缺陷;内核、基础库长期保持一致;广泛用于生产级服务器(尤其X_X、X_X、ISP)。
⭐⭐⭐⭐☆
LTS 版本(如 22.04/24.04)也高度稳定,但默认启用更多后台服务(如 snapdfwupdubuntu-advantage-tools),部分组件更新策略更激进(如内核热补丁、安全更新机制)。
轻量性(资源占用) ⭐⭐⭐⭐⭐
最小化安装仅 ~300–400MB 磁盘;无 snap 强制依赖;默认不安装 GUI、无关守护进程;systemd 配置精简;内存常驻约 150–200MB(空闲状态)。
⭐⭐⭐☆☆
最小化安装约 450–600MB;默认集成 snapd(即使不用也会驻留服务,占用内存+磁盘);部分云镜像预装 cloud-init 扩展组件较多;空闲内存略高(~200–250MB)。
软件包更新策略 固定生命周期(约 5 年支持 + 2 年 LTS 延长),期间只接受安全修复和严重 bug 修复绝不升级主版本(如 Python 3.11 在 Bookworm 中始终是 3.11.x,不会升到 3.12)。 LTS 版本同样提供 5 年支持,但会通过 ubuntu-pro 提供扩展支持;部分关键组件(如内核、Python)可能通过 HWE 或 backport 升级,带来轻微兼容性风险(极小,但存在)。
云平台适配 所有主流云厂商(AWS、阿里云、腾讯云、DigitalOcean)均提供官方 Debian 镜像,优化良好;cloud-init 支持完善。 云原生适配最强(尤其 AWS/Azure),但部分国产云对 Debian 支持同样优秀。
运维友好性 包管理纯粹(apt + .deb),文档严谨,社区/企业支持成熟;适合追求可控性的运维人员。 同样基于 apt,但需注意 snap 干扰(如 core, snapd 自动更新)、unattended-upgrades 默认更激进。

🚫 注意避坑点(Ubuntu 的隐性“非轻量”因素):

  • snapd 是 Ubuntu Server LTS 的强制依赖(即使你不用 snap,它仍作为系统服务运行,占用约 30–50MB 内存 + 定期轮询更新)。
  • fwupd(固件更新服务)、apport(错误报告)、whoopsie 等默认启用,可禁用但需额外配置。
  • 某些云厂商 Ubuntu 镜像预装 ubuntu-advantage-tools(UA 服务),增加启动项与后台任务。

Debian 的优势实操体现

  • debootstrap 构建的最小系统可低至 250MB 磁盘 + <120MB 内存(纯命令行 + nginx + php-fpm);
  • 无 snap、无争议性后台服务,ps aux --forest 进程树干净;
  • /etc/apt/sources.list 极简,无第三方仓库污染风险;
  • SELinux/AppArmor 默认未启用(更轻),如需可手动开启。

✅ 最终建议:

  • Web 服务首选(Nginx + PHP/Python + DB)→ Debian 12 (Bookworm) Stable
    尤其适合:静态/动态网站、API 服务、中小流量业务、资源敏感型云实例(如 1C1G)、追求长期零维护的场景。

  • 选 Ubuntu Server 的合理场景

    • 需要最新硬件支持(如新网卡/显卡驱动 → Ubuntu HWE 内核更及时);
    • 团队已深度绑定 Canonical 生态(如使用 Landscape、Ubuntu Pro、Livepatch);
    • 依赖 Snap 分发的应用(如某些 CI 工具或数据库);
    • 使用 MicroK8s / LXD 等 Canonical 原生容器方案。

💡 Bonus:部署小贴士

# Debian 最小化加固(推荐)
sudo apt update && sudo apt full-upgrade -y
sudo apt autoremove --purge -y && sudo apt clean
sudo systemctl disable --now snapd.socket snapd apparmor fwupd whoopsie apport
sudo sed -i 's/^# deb-src/deb-src/' /etc/apt/sources.list

✅ 总结:Debian Stable = 稳如磐石 + 轻如鸿毛;Ubuntu LTS = 稳而周全 + 生态丰富。对于纯粹 Web 服务部署,Debian 是更精准匹配「稳定 & 轻量」双目标的选择。

如需具体镜像下载链接(官方/国内源)、一键初始化脚本或 Nginx+PHP-FPM 最小化部署指南,我可立即为你提供 👇